Output 121d67d7a9a63fe663d601d20b5bdc34962532a9457ac676a475bdd09fb65a60:1

value
24850966
script pubkey
OP_0 OP_PUSHBYTES_20 74edfc08b4bc52dfd349ffd3d59313394ff6b228
address
bc1qwnklcz95h3fdl56fllfatycn898ldv3gty4n5a
transaction
121d67d7a9a63fe663d601d20b5bdc34962532a9457ac676a475bdd09fb65a60
spent
true